2003 Toyota VIOS 1.5E review from Malaysia

"Vios, You'll want one"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

None. Except the Factory fitted tyre, Eagle NCT cause the car wuuung... wuuuung... due to the uneven surface of the tyre, sound like spoilt bearing sound. Problem solved after replace the tyres to Yokohama tyre.

General comments?

Pros:

-superior fuel economy compared with my previous car, camry 2.0. Rm55 can travel around 435km.

-well handling with the min. turning radius. idea for tight parking.

-good sound insulation

-bright headlights that make you feel 'day' when night.

Cons:

-cramped and uncomfortable rear seat

-no retractable side mirror like camry

-no height adjustable for driver seat

-poor quality fuel lid.
